Default More or Less back pressure

this is my first year racing 4cylinders ive always been a v8 kinda guy ...so when i started making my car i thought about punching out the cat and shortin up the pipe for more flow...like you would for a v8...i was told that a 4 clyinder needs back pressure to run right and punching out the cat kills the power..any truth to this...

Default RE: More or Less back pressure

Neons do need some backpressure, not as much as Honda's but as long as you have a muffler even a high flow you should have enuf backpressure. However you can run straight pipe and have no side affects other then being deaf an hour later.
